البطاقات

تظهر الإضافة المستندة إلى البطاقة كلوحة في الشريط الجانبي (أو على الجوّال، كنافذة نشاط أخرى تم الوصول إليها من خلال القائمة). تتضمن الإضافة شريط أدوات في أعلى الصفحة يعرّف الإضافة، ويعرض بطاقة، وهي في الأساس &page;quot; تمثّل "برمجة التطبيقات" البطاقات في رمز المشروع باستخدام عناصر Card.

بنية البطاقة

مثال على بطاقة إضافة

والبطاقة هي مجموعة من عناصر واجهة المستخدم التي تصمّمها. تتألف البطاقة من الأقسام التالية:

  • عنوان البطاقة: يحدد هذا الإجراء البطاقات. وهي تحتوي على نص عنوان، وقد يكون اختياريًا عنوانًا فرعيًا ورمزًا.
  • قسم بطاقة واحد أو أكثر. وهذه أقسام فرعية من منطقة واجهة المستخدم في البطاقة. قد يكون للقسم عنوان قسم نصي اختياريًا. تُفصل أقسام البطاقات عن بعضها البعض على البطاقة باستخدام قاعدة أفقية. في حال كان قسم البطاقة كبيرًا بشكل خاص، يتم عرضه تلقائيًا كقسم قابل للتصغير يمكن للمستخدمين توسيعه أو تصغيره حسب الحاجة. يمكن أن تحتوي البطاقة على ما لا يزيد عن 100 قسم من البطاقات، ويجب ألا يتوفر سوى عدد قليل منها لتحسين الأداء.

  • يتضمّن كلّ قسم من بطاقات واجهة مستخدم واحدة أو أكثر التطبيقات المصغّرة. وتوفّر الأدوات للمستخدم معلومات أو عناصر تحكّم تفاعلية. تُعد أقسام البطاقات والبطاقات أدوات بنية، لذا لا يمكنك إضافتها إلى قسم البطاقة. يمكن أن يتضمن قسم البطاقة ما لا يزيد عن 100 أداة، ويجب أن يكون بسيطًا قدر الإمكان لتحقيق أفضل أداء.

يجب تصميم بطاقات حول أنشطة مستخدمين أو مجموعات بيانات محددة. على سبيل المثال، قد تحتوي إضافة Google Workspace التي تعرض البيانات المأخوذة من "جداول بيانات Google" على بطاقة منفصلة لكل ورقة بيانات تستمد البيانات منها.

استخدام بطاقات متعددة

مثال على بطاقة إضافة

تتكون الإضافات عادةً من أكثر من بطاقة واحدة. يمكنك ضبط هذه البطاقات كقائمة بسيطة للتنقّل الأساسي باستخدام بطاقات متعددة، أو ضبط طرق التنقّل الأكثر تعقيدًا للتحكّم في كيفية انتقال المستخدم بين البطاقات.

إذا كانت الإضافة تستخدم ميزة التنقّل الأساسية، عند فتح الإضافة لأول مرة، تعمل هذه الإضافة على توسيع قائمة عناوين العناوين وتقديمها إلى المستخدم. ويؤدي النقر على عنوان البطاقة إلى فتح هذه البطاقة. يتم أيضًا عرض سهم الرجوع للعودة إلى قائمة عنوان البطاقة. وليس عليك ترميز وظائف رأس الصفحة وسهم الرجوع، حيث يتم ذلك تلقائيًا عند تحديد البطاقات في إضافتك.

عند تصميم إضافات، من الأفضل الحدّ من عدد البطاقات التي تعرضها في آن واحد، لأنّ البطاقات يجب أن تضمّ مساحة محدودة من الشاشة. من الأفضل أيضًا تجنّب استخدام تعقيدات غير ضرورية في البطاقات.